Victor matrix B-29071. You're in Kentucky sure as you're born / Garber-Davis Orchestra

TitleSource
You're in Kentucky sure as you're born (Primary title)Disc label (RDI)
Fox trot (Title descriptor)Disc label (RDI)
Authors and ComposersNotes
Larry Shay (composer)
Haven Gillespie (composer)
Composer information source: Disc label.
PersonnelNotes Hide Additional Titles
Garber-Davis Orchestra (Musical group)
Jan Garber (leader)
Milton Davis (instrumentalist : piano)
  • Description: Jazz/dance band
  • Instrumentation: Violin, banjo, 2 cornets, piano, trombone, 3 saxophones, tuba, and traps
  • Category: Instrumental
  • Master Size: 10-in.
  • Title Note: Disc label also credits lyricist [George A.] Little.

Take Date and PlaceTakeStatusLabel Name/NumberFormatNote Hide Additional Titles
12/7/1923 Camden, New Jersey 1 Destroy
12/7/1923 Camden, New Jersey 2 Destroy
12/7/1923 Camden, New Jersey 3 Hold
12/7/1923 Camden, New Jersey 4 Destroy
12/7/1923 Camden, New Jersey 5 Master Victor 19216 10-in.
